NATIVE AMERICAN PLACE NAMES
FINAL JEOPARDY! CLUE
You have to go through military security to reach this town with a marine base on 3 sides & the Potomac on the other
Stephanie Garrone-Shufran: 1800-1800=0
Jon Beebe: 12400-5601=6799
Robert Weibezahl: 9000+2000=11000 (New Champ)
Correct response:
Spoiler
Quantico (Stephanie – Alexandria) (Jon – Tappahannock)
Daily Doubles
Stephanie: 1200-1200
Robert: 4200+2000
Jon: 11200+2000
Coryats
Stephanie: 3000
Jon: 12000
Robert: 8600
Combined: 23,600
